Yes — Perth is 4.3x larger than Mexico City by area. Perth spans 6,417 km² (2,478 mi²) while Mexico City covers 1,485 km² (573 mi²) — a difference of 4,932 km². You could fit Mexico City inside Perth approximately 4 times.
To put Mexico City's size in perspective, its area of 1,485 km² is roughly the same size as London. Meanwhile, Perth at 6,417 km² is roughly the same size as Shanghai.
In more relatable units, Mexico City's 1,485 km² is about 208,000 American football fields, 25 times the area of Manhattan, or 14 times the area of Paris. Perth works out to about 899,000 American football fields, 110 times the area of Manhattan, or 61 times the area of Paris.
Mexico City is the capital and most populous city of Mexico, as well as the most populous city in North America. It is one of the most important cultural and financial centers in the world, and is classified as an Alpha world city according to the Globalization and World Cities Research Network (GaWC) 2024 ranking. Mexico City is located in the Valley of Mexico within the high Mexican central plateau, at an altitude of 2,240 meters.
Known as "CDMX", Mexico City covers 1,485 km² with a population of 9.2 million. The city was established in 1325. Mexico City is known for Zocalo square, Chapultepec Park, Frida Kahlo Museum, among other attractions. The city's main transit system is the Mexico City Metro.

Perth is the capital city of Western Australia. It is the fourth-most-populous city in Australia, with a population of over 2.3 million within Greater Perth as of 2023. The world's most isolated major city by certain criteria, Perth is part of the South West Land Division of Western Australia, with most of Perth's metropolitan area on the Swan Coastal Plain between the Indian Ocean and the Darling Scarp.
Also known as "City of Light", Perth has an area of 6,417 km² and is home to 2.1 million people. Its history stretches back to 1829. Visitors come for Swan River, Kings Park, Cottesloe Beach, and much more.

Mexico City has a population density of 6,202 people per km² — a densely populated city. Perth, with 333 people per km², is a low-density, sprawling urban area. Mexico City is dramatically more crowded, with 18.6x the population density.
